A demonstration of how you can actually make trap with a "fully-audiotool-made sample" - that is, making a "sample" using synths, effects and a machiniste instead of lazily using a sample from another song (which is bad not necessarily because of audiotool not wanting GEMA on its tail, because it just sounds bad, bland and uncreative).

This time, the """""sample""""" isn't even "bounced" into an actual sample - the sample is "played live" (e.g. using note tracks instead of Audiotracks). Open the song to see what I mean there.

In the middle section, there's a "glitchy" kind of section where the sample is glitched in part with the Rasselbock - this was painful to make since the ""sample"" had to be manipulated "also live", as it wasn't bounced or baked or something.

Moreover, I added the "typical trap siren" using just a synth and some effects - it is also played live.

There are bonus tracks: one is the trap drums and the ""sample""'s drums without the keys and the bass; while another is the """""original sample""""", which is actually an extension of the "sample" chops used in the song proper.
